Scapteriscus borellii[8][9][10][11][12][13][14][15][3][16][17][18][19][20][21] är en insektsart som beskrevs av Giglio-tos 1894. Scapteriscus borellii ingår i släktet Scapteriscus och familjen mullvadssyrsor.[22][23] Inga underarter finns listade i Catalogue of Life.[22]
